Richard Socher to Speak on AI Generating and Testing Scientific Hypotheses
PolarBearby · x · 2026-08-01
You.com shared a preview of founder Richard Socher's upcoming talk at the UC Berkeley Agentic AI Summit. Titled "The Eureka Machine: Recursive Superintelligence for Science," the presentation will focus on AI agents capable of autonomously generating and testing scientific hypotheses.
